Marvin Harrison was considered one of the most polished wide receivers entering the 1996 NFL Draft. Known for his exceptional route-running ability, hands, and football IQ, he was seen as a player who could make an immediate impact in the NFL.
Strengths:Marvin Harrison was projected to be a first-round pick in the 1996 NFL Draft. His strong collegiate performance and skill set made him one of the top wide receivers available, and many analysts believed he would be a valuable addition to any NFL team looking to bolster their receiving corps.
Conclusion:Marvin Harrison was highly regarded as a talented wide receiver with the potential to excel at the next level. His combination of route-running, hands, and intelligence set him apart as a top prospect in the 1996 NFL Draft.
